The Golden Lion

The story follows Tarzan after his return to Africa, where he becomes involved in new adventures. While traveling, he rescues a lion cub and raises it into a powerful full-grown companion, the “Golden Lion.” The story takes Tarzan into a lost city ruled by a cruel and superstitious priesthood, where human sacrifice and dark secrets abound. Tarzan and his loyal lion face enemies both savage and cunning, including conspirators plotting against him.

First published in 1922, this edition is derived from the original book with 8 black & white illustrations by J. Allen St. John. As always, this edition is complete and unabridged.

About the Author

Edgar Rice Burroughs was an American author best known for creating the iconic character Tarzan and the Barsoom series, featuring John Carter of Mars. Born on September 1, 1875, in Chicago, Illinois, Burroughs had a diverse career path before becoming a prolific writer.
